Trogir Old Town

Trogir is a UNESCO-listed medieval town on a tiny island connected by bridges to the mainland and the island of Ciovo. Free to walk. The Cathedral of St Lawrence has a Romanesque portal by Master Radovan (one of the finest medieval carvings in Croatia). The Kamerlengo Fortress at the western tip charges a small fee for sunset views. Budget travelers take the cheap bus or ferry from Split (30 minutes), walk the car-free stone streets, and discover a miniature Dubrovnik with a fraction of the crowds and none of the prices.
